Top 10 African Stock Exchanges Ranked by Listings
The OECD Africa Capital Markets Report 2025 shows that by the end of 2024, African exchanges listed 1,141 companies—about 5% of the 44,000 global listings— with a total market capitalization of $561 billion, roughly one-third of the continent’s GDP.

Equatorial Guinea's Capital Moved From Island to Mainland to Improve Security &
President Teodoro Obiang Nguema Mbasogo signed a decree declaring Ciudad de la Paz the new capital of the republic, stripping Malabo of that status.
